Transformative Mentoring for Lasting Impact
This year, our focus is on deep, transformative mentoring relationships that go beyond skill-building to foster spiritual, personal, and professional growth. A Lead by the Name mentor is more than an advisor—they are an empowerer, guide, and role model, helping mentees navigate leadership challenges with clarity and confidence. Through one-on-one mentoring, mentees gain:
✅ Strategic Problem-Solving – Tackling real-life challenges with wisdom and discernment.
✅ Experience-Driven Learning – Drawing insights from past successes and failures.
✅ Leadership Capacity-Building – Strengthening decision-making, vision, and emotional intelligence.
✅ Mission-Driven Planning – Defining actionable steps to achieve long-term impact.
✅ Resilient Habits – Cultivating focus, productivity, and perseverance in ministry and leadership.
In a rapidly changing world, leaders need more than knowledge—they need mentorship that is relational, transformative, and deeply rooted in biblical principles.
